Board of Trustees,
Police Pension Fund
Minutes of Regular Quarterly Board Meeting held
Tuesday, July 11, 1978. Meeting Held in The
Staff Conference Room, Municipal Building, 901
Wellington Avenue, Elk Grove Village, Illinois.
Prepared by; Eugene E. Brandt
Trustee-Secretary
93
President Diemer called the meeting to order at 7:15 P.M.
Roll call of officers; President Diemer, Vice President Jones,
Secretary Brandt, Assistant Secretary Farley, all present and
Treasurer Coney excused to attend important village board
meeting.
Minutes of the previous meeting held on Tuesday, April 18, 1978
which were previously distributed, were read and motion by
Diemer and 2nd by Farley to accept as written.
A motion was made by Farley and 2nd by Jones to authorize the
return of funds contributed by Ronald Iden who resigned from
the police department and requested the refund of his money in
writing to the pension board. Check for $ 10,507.23 was issued.
Secretary Brandt brought to the attention of the board that
$ 55,700.00 was available for investment. President Diemer to
check interest rates for current deposits and will advise best
investment.
President Diemer advised on Wednesday, July 12, 1978 that the
best investment currently is U.S. Treasury certificates at 8-4
per cent interest. $ 50,000.00 so invested, with balance to
remain in checking account.
A lengthy discussion was held on the current status of pension
funds statewide, as was the benefits of a younger officer
staying on active duty for 30 years, as opposed to 20 years.
70% pension for 30 years service as opposed to 50% pension for
20 years service.
Being no further business to discuss, the meeting was adjourned
at 8:23 P.M.
